About North County Recreation District
North County Recreation District became operational in 1997 following voter approval of a proposal to maintain and enhance a community center, fitness center, and pool destined for closure. The rich story of the facility we now call NCRD began long before. The historic building, originally a school, was designed by renowned Portland architect AE Doyle and built in the early 1920's.
